FC Barcelona delivered a stunning performance against Real Valladolid, securing a 7-0 victory that has left fans and analysts in awe. The match, which took place on August 31, 2024, at Camp Nou, was a clear statement of the team’s current strength and potential under the guidance of new coach Hansi Flick. Leading the charge was Brazilian winger Raphinha, who not only scored his first hat-trick for the club but also provided an assist, firmly establishing himself as a key player in Barcelona’s quest for domestic and European glory this season.

From the very first whistle, Barcelona dominated Valladolid, and it was Raphinha who set the tone for what would be a night to remember. The Brazilian winger, who faced criticism last season and was rumored to be on his way out due to the club’s financial struggles, showed why he remains an essential part of the team. His pace, skill, and finishing were on full display, leaving Valladolid’s defense scrambling to keep up.

Raphinha’s first goal came early in the game, a powerful strike from the edge of the box that left the goalkeeper with no chance. He followed this up with a clinical finish after a beautiful build-up play involving Frenkie de Jong and Dani Olmo. The hat-trick was completed with a deft header, rounding off a perfect performance that saw him named Man of the Match.

After the game, Raphinha was quick to downplay the need for any new signings, stating, “The team is in excellent shape. We are working hard, and today’s result reflects that. Our coach, Hansi Flick, was on the sidelines urging us to score more goals, and that’s our mentality.” His comments suggest a team fully confident in their abilities and depth, even after losing several key players over the summer.

Barcelona’s 7-0 victory wasn’t just about the scoreline; it was a statement of intent. With four consecutive wins in La Liga, the team sits comfortably at the top of the table, five points clear of second-placed Villarreal. This dominance is even more impressive given the financial constraints that forced the club to part ways with players like Ilkay Gundogan and Clement Lenglet.

Despite these departures, Barcelona has managed to strengthen their squad with the addition of Dani Olmo, who has quickly adapted to the team’s style of play. Olmo’s partnership with Raphinha on the wings has added a new dimension to Barcelona’s attack, making them more unpredictable and lethal in front of goal.

While Barcelona fans celebrated their team’s masterclass, it was a night to forget for Real Valladolid. The newly-promoted side was outplayed in every department, with coach Paulo Pezzolano admitting after the match that his team simply couldn’t compete. “I want to apologize to the supporters and the city, they don’t deserve it. We didn’t compete today. It was pitiful. There’s no other word, there are no excuses,” Pezzolano lamented.

Valladolid had attempted to replicate the strategy that nearly worked against Real Madrid the previous week, where they held Los Blancos to a single goal until the 88th minute. However, Barcelona’s high press and quick transitions overwhelmed them, exposing tactical flaws that Pezzolano acknowledged in his post-match comments.

Hansi Flick’s influence on Barcelona is already evident. The Blaugrana are not just winning; they are doing so with a style of play that blends possession-based football with verticality and high pressing. This tactical evolution makes them a more formidable opponent, particularly against teams that attempt to sit back and defend deep.

Raphinha, who has been given a more central role under Flick, is thriving in this system. His ability to cut inside and create scoring opportunities, combined with the freedom to express himself on the pitch, has seen him emerge as one of the standout performers in La Liga this season.
